FIRE DESTROYS MILLIONS WORTH OF GOODS IN ONITSHA

It was another dark day in Onitsha, Anambra State, yesterday, as fire gutted the bridge head market of the Association of Medical and Pharmaceutical Products Dealers , Onitsha..

Goods worth over one hundred million naira were destroyed in the fire incident which is said to have started at about 6am, at the Redemption Line of the market.

Eyewitnesses say it would have gutted the whole market, but for the timely intervention of the men of Fire Service from Onitsha Main market and Building Materials Market, Ogidi, invited by the leadership of the market.

President of Association of Medical and Pharmaceutical Products Delears, Mr. Uche Eze, said he was called by market security men at about 6.15 am yesterday, that there was fire outbreak at Redemption Line and he quickly called men of the Fire Service from Onitsha Main Market and Building Material Market, Ogidi

He appealed to Governor Willie Obiano to come to the assistance of the affected traders as they have lost all they have been working for over the years in just one incident and for the Governor to provide fire service equipment in the market to tackle similar problems in future.”
